Giovanni Lanfranco - The Funeral of a Roman Emperor [c.1636]

The Emperor's funeral was one of the key ceremonies in imperial Rome, it was a preparation for his deification. It was a solemn ceremony that culminated in the act of cremation. The embalmed body of the deceased was arranged on a pyre, around which grieving demonstrations occurred. In the foreground several pairs of gladiators are fighting, an allusion to the funeral games which were held in honour of the emperor.

 

[Museo Nacional del Prado, Madrid - Oil on canvas, 335 x 488 cm]
